Search for the Standard Model Higgs boson in the Hτ+τH \to \tau^+ \tau^- decay mode in s\sqrt{s} = 7 TeV pp collisions with ATLAS

A search for the Standard Model Higgs boson decaying into a pair of tau leptons is reported. The analysis is based on a data sample of proton-proton collisions collected by the ATLAS experiment at the LHC and corresponding to an integrated luminosity of 4.7 fb^{-}1. No significant excess over the expected background is observed in the Higgs boson mass range of 100-150 GeV. The observed (expected) upper limits on the cross section times the branching ratio for Hτ+τH \to \tau^+ \tau^- are found to be between 2.9 (3.4) and 11.7 (8.2) times the Standard Model prediction for this mass range.
